King's Lynn 1-1 AFC Telford Utd

Blue Square North

King's Lynn battled hard against third-placed AFC Telford United in a match that came to life after half-time.

Telford only took the lead 10 minutes from the final whistle, Andy Brown putting the ball past Lynn keeper Scott Howie with a shot off his shin.

Just five minutes later Lynn were back on level terms, Luke Graham tapping home a loose ball from just two yards.

The game had started nervously, both sides apparently unwilling to repeat disappointing New Year's Day results.

Telford's shock home defeat to Stafford Rangers had cost them the chance to go top of the Blue Square North. But Saturday's draw took Rob Smith's side to within two points of leaders Tamworth, whose trip to Burscough was called off.

But the gap could increase as Telford are not due back in league action until 17 January when they host Hyde United.

Before then they face two cup ties, also at the Bucks Head - this Saturday's FA Trophy date with Hayes & Yeading United (10 January, 1500 GMT) and next Tuesday night's Setanta Shield clash with Kettering Town (13 January, 1945 GMT).
